Asphalt Plant Operator
ASPHALT PLANT FOREMAN JOB FUNCTIONS
-- Operating a Mobile Asphalt Plant with up-to-date computerized equipment controls
- Oversee plant maintenance and operation
- Ensure that the equipment & plant functions as designed at all time
- Assist with troubleshooting equipment malfunctions in order to minimize downtime as well as striving to improve equipment/plant operating efficiency to maximize production, save time, save fuel, and minimize labor
- In charge of plant tear-down and plant sets
- Daily reporting
JOB REQUIREMENTS
-- Seeking a candidate with at least two (2) seasons of experience operating a hot asphalt plant; however, we are willing to perform additional training as required
- Moderate to heavy lifting, bending, reaching above shoulder level, climbing stairs and ladders frequently, kneeling, and stooping
- Clear and effective communication skills (speech, vision, hearing/listening, writing, etc.)
- Valid driver license
- Ability to pass pre-employment DRUG test and random DRUG &/or alcohol screens
WORK WEEK / JOB DURATION
- Typically work 50 to 70+ hours, 5-6 days per week, depending on the weather & project status. Work is generally from thaw until freeze-up.COMPENSATION
